Human rights group Suaram alleged a man was yesterday detained under the Prevention of Crime Act (Poca) 1959, after being subjected to repeated arrests in the last three weeks.
Suaram executive director Sevan Doraisamy said in a statement today that L Thuraisinggam, 24, was initially picked up by the Petaling Jaya police on May 25, for allegedly for being a member of a robbery gang called "Gang Koki".
He was then released, before being re-arrested six more times and placed under police custody in different jurisdictions, namely Shah Alam, Gombak, Sungai Buloh, Brickfields and Dang Wangi...
